The 2022 Monte Carlo Masters is entering its last stages. Here’s a look at the semi-final previews, live streaming details and our predictions for the games on Saturday.

The semi-finals for the Men’s Singles at the Monte Carlo Masters have been set. The SF games of the tournament will take place on Saturday, with Grigor Dimitrov set to face Alejandro Davidovich-Fokina and Stefanos Tsitsipas on course to defend his title against Alexander Zverev in the other SF.

Monte Carlo Masters SF1: Grigor Dimitrov vs Alejandro Davidovich-Fokina preview and prediction

Dimitrov pulled off a stunning upset against Casper Ruud in the quarter-finals. Despite being a rather unfamiliar face in the semi-finals, he has managed to get wins in tough battles. This shows that the Bulgarian is arguably in the form of his life and could be onto something special at the Monte Carlo Masters this year. The 30-year-old will now face another stern challenge in the form of Fokina in the semis.

Meanwhile, Alejandro Davidovich-Fokina is enjoying a dream run at the clay tournament as well. The Spaniard is fast gaining a reputation as a clay-court specialist after beating the likes of Novak Djokovic and Taylor Fritz in Monaco this year. The youngster is now on course to reach his first ever final.

These two players have met each other just once before with Fokina beating Dimitrov. However, our prediction for the SF on Saturday is a win in three sets for Dimitrov.

Monte Carlo Masters SF 2: Stefanos Tsitsipas vs Alexander Zverev preview and prediction

In what promises to be an intense game on Saturday, Tsitsipas will lock horns with Zverev. Zverev managed to grind out a win over Jannik Sinner in a third set tiebreak, and Tsitsipas had to fight back from 4-0 down in the third against Diego Schwartzman in the quarter-finals of the tournament.

But both these players will know what it takes to get an advantage over the other. Tsitsipas and Zverev have played each other nine times, with the Greek holding the better 6-3 recover over the German. Our prediction is a win in three sets for Tsitsipas.
